I wanted to hate Mrs. Brown's Boys from a snooty "Oh how simplistic, darling!" and, "Doesn't it pander to the populist mugs who don't know any better and will accept any old shit, luvvie" comedy snob's standpoint.

Vitriol at the ready and impatient to slam its grubby, infantile and vulgar humour I tuned in to series 1 ep. 1. Immediately I found myself laughing like a drain. Sure, it was clichéd, sure, it was broad, but above all else, bloody sure it was hilarious! From then onwards I have loved it. It goes against nearly every one of my own comedy instincts and yet I love it. Why?

Well, for me anyway, it only goes to prove that the whole is more than the sum of all of the parts. It has that certain je ne sais quoi which only happens once in a blue moon, allowing it to transcend the negative comments it gets and to laugh back at the turned-up noses people point in its direction. It has a warmth and spirit that no other sitcom I have seen on TV comes close to capturing (except perhaps Minder in its heyday which may not count in this context).
